Whether BDNF (Brain-Derived Neurotrophic Factor) can help with allergies is not scientifically well-established. BDNF is primarily known as a growth factor for neurons and plays a role in synaptic plasticity. Emerging research suggests BDNF is involved in immune modulation, particularly in allergic airway diseases like asthma. Some studies show elevated BDNF levels in asthmatic lungs, potentially contributing to inflammation. However, evidence is conflicting: some indicate pro-inflammatory effects, others protective. No high-quality clinical trials support BDNF as a treatment for allergies. Consumer DNA tests (e.g., MyBody-X) may analyze BDNF variants, but clinical relevance for allergies is unclear. Any effect would be indirect via inflammatory pathways. Currently, BDNF supplementation or genetic testing for allergy management lacks evidence. Established allergy treatments include allergen avoidance, antihistamines, and immunotherapy. The evidence for BDNF in allergies remains mechanistic and insufficient for recommendations.
